HOUSING AUTHORITY OF CITY OF EVERETT v. TERRY

No. 56716-6.

114 Wn.2d 558 (1990)

789 P.2d 745

HOUSING AUTHORITY OF THE CITY OF EVERETT, Respondent, v. RAY TERRY, Appellant.

The Supreme Court of Washington, En Banc.

April 19, 1990.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Robert S. Friedman and Gregory D. Provenzano of Evergreen Legal Services, for appellant.

Newton, Kight, Adams & Castleberry, by Lorna S. Corrigan, for respondent.


SMITH, J.

Respondent Housing Authority of the City of Everett brought an unlawful detainer action under our landlord and tenant act, RCW Title 59, against Appellant Ray Terry, a mentally handicapped person, for breach of a lease covenant by creating a "threat to the health and safety of other residents" of the housing complex. But respondent did not comply with the notice provisions of RCW 59.12.030(4) which require a 10-day opportunity to comply with a breached covenant...
